Course Content

• Science Communication Principles and Theories
• Marine Ecosystem Dynamics and Conservation (Marine conservation, oceanography)
• Strategic Communication for Marine Science (Stakeholder engagement, media relations)
• Marine Science Communication Leadership: Building Effective Teams (Teamwork, leadership skills)
• Developing and Delivering Compelling Narratives about the Ocean (Storytelling, science writing)
• Digital Media and Marine Science Communication (Social media, web design)
• Crisis Communication and Risk Management in Marine Science (Reputation management, public safety)
• Ethics and Responsibility in Marine Science Communication (Environmental ethics, scientific integrity)

Career path

Career Role (Marine Science Communication Leadership) Description
Marine Science Communications Manager Develops and implements communication strategies for marine science organizations; manages teams and projects, ensuring effective dissemination of research findings to diverse audiences.
Science Writer/Journalist (Marine Focus) Creates engaging and accurate content about marine science topics for various media; strong writing, editing, and research skills are crucial for this role.
Marine Conservation Education Specialist Educates the public on marine conservation issues; develops curriculum and outreach programs; promotes responsible stewardship of marine ecosystems.
Marine Policy Analyst & Communicator Analyzes marine policy, communicates findings to policymakers and stakeholders, contributing to evidence-based decision-making within marine conservation.
